XeniT Customer List

Below is a selection of our customers:

Customer

ECM project

 

Vivium

Insurance

Multi million archiving solution, CAStor based storage, high volume scanning and recognition , high volume mainframe output, automated classification, disaster recovery, ...


P&V

Insurance

Collaboration platform exchanging document with the agents for commercial strategie and client file follow up.

 

 

VERA

Governement

'Digital Social House' - Alfresco Credit Crunch Innovation Awards 2009. Collaboration platform managing and publishing the information on social services and rights.

E-Raden - Hosted ECM platform enabling municipalities to manage and share documents.

UZ Brussel

Hospital

Managing multiple document processes, managing board meetings

Actel

Insurance

Web site content production and handling of the interaction with the user.

The Actel web site is driven by Alfresco's WCM module.

ING

Banking

ECM strategy to support documentation processes of Banking applications. We design a content based knowledge management system. We assist in picking the right document models, and mixing wiki and documents to store application documentation.

Brutex

Manufacturing and distribution of textiles

E-mail archiving in Alfresco ECM. Features an outlook integration with Alfresco. Source of inspiration for our Fred component, XeniT's Alfresco desktop client.

OTB

Manufacturing

Publishing content to intranet, supporting project and product documentation, e-mail archiving, scanning of correspondance.

NewTec

Telecom, Development and manufacturing

ECM platform supporting the product documentation processes and the ISO processes. Includes template control, meta-data integration and jBPM workflow implementation.

Blonde

Publishing, Marketing Communication Service

Production of marketing material, sharing the the material with the customer network and order. Implements the process from material production to multi-channel publication.

 Euromerger

Corporate Finance

Web site for the Euromerger group, built upon Alfresco and a Drupal front-end.
